iMac G4 700.
Recently installed software for Canon LiDE 30 USB, software seemed to work ok. iMac would not awake from sleep. Had to unplug. Now I only get a flashing folder/question mark icon on startup. Cannot zap PRAM - only black screen until I let the keys go. Booted into open firmware, reset PRAM (reset-nvram, reset-all). Same problem on reboot. Any ideas? :confused: |
